Description
  • From the March 22, 1968, issue of the Crimson: "In the Men's Division, first place winner Pi Kappa Phi tried to determine how to best serve this country, as a patriotic program, picturing marines in battle and a hippy protesting war, unfolded. Songs 'This Is My County,' 'No Man Is An Island,' and 'I Believe' were used. The red, white and blue worn by the group and the display of a US flag combined to create the mood for the singing of 'America.'"
